5.6.1.1.(2)
+
Application
Application 1: 
Components and assemblies, of buildings described in Sentence 1.3.3.2.(1) of Division A, that are exposed to precipitation, where it can be shown that the lack of control of precipitation ingress will not adversely affect health, safety, the intended use of the building or the operation of building services.
Application 2: 
This also applies to cladding assemblies installed on buildings to which Part 9 applies [see Sentence 1.3.3.3.(1) of Division A for application of Part 9] where:
  • the cladding assembly is not addressed in Section 9.27., or
  • the cladding assembly does not comply with the prescriptive requirements of Section 9.27.

Intent
Intent 1: 
To exempt situations from the application of Section 5.6., where it can be shown that the lack of control of precipitation ingress will not adversely affect health, safety, the intended use of the building or the operation of building services.
